Remotorization of the aircraft EV-55 Outback
Puller, Tomáš ; Weis, Martin (referee) ; Horák, Marek (advisor)
Thesis Remotorization of the aircraft EV-55 Outback deals with possibility of installationt piston diesel engine instead of turboprop engine PT6A-21. Begining of this thesis deals with choice of convenient engine and propeller. Then, 3D model of engine bed is designed, followed by mass analysis. Based on results from the mass analysis and requirements from the CS - 23 regulation, load is specified and stress analysis is done. The other part of this thesis deals with adjustment of the airframe and with calculation of flight performances. Finally, economic indices are specified.

Common-rail System for 4-cylinder CI-engine
Ošmera, Petr ; Svída, David (referee) ; Dundálek, Radim (advisor)
This diploma thesis with a view to „common rail system for 4-cylinder CI-engine“ deals with the application of modern injection system „common rail“ to already existing compression-ignition tractor engine. The diploma thesis treats of the most necessary adjustments related with the replacement of injection systems which was solved in the way of the minimum adjustments. This kind of solution deals with an economic aspect of the problem. The reconstruction contains the engineering design of development of high pressure components and the suitability of their placing on engine.The primary adjustment of the application of system „common rail“ for existing tractor engine confirmed the possibility of this reconstruction.
